1.17 ESTIMATION OF BODY SURFACE AREA

               The body surface area is the measured or calculated surface of a human body. The body surface area is used in many measurements in medicine, including the calculation of drug dosages and the amount of fluids to be administered intravenously. The body surface area

 

can be calculated by various formulas without direct measurement. When weight and height are known, the formula of DuBois and DuBois (1) published in 1916 is recommended.

               (1) The body surface area (m2 ) = Height (cm)0.725 × Weight (kg)0.425 × 71.84 × 10–4

               The table of the body surface area from weight and height, which is calculated from the formula of DuBois and DuBois, is represented in the following pages.

               A simplified formula, which can be calculated for the body surface area, is commonly known as the Mosteller formula (2) published in 1987.

               (2) The body surface area (m2 ) = [Weight (kg) × Height (cm)/3600]1/2
